I will admit I purchased the Stark and JAG series from Baen once they were finally released in ebook form. Thought they were quiet enjoyable.

Another series that I found good easy reads were the Kris Longknife series by Mike Shepherd and Vatta's War by Elizabeth Moon

Hard to beat the Lensman series by EE "Doc" Smith
